Frequently Asked Questions About Apple Pay Casinos in Australia

Is Apple Pay safe for online casino deposits?

Yes, it’s safer than using your card directly. Apple Pay uses tokenization. Your real card number is never sent to the casino. It’s a one-time code. Plus, you use Face ID or Touch ID, so no one can access it if your phone is stolen.

What is the minimum deposit for Apple Pay at Australian casinos?

It varies. Most sites allow $5 to $10. Some have a $20 minimum. Always check the cashier page before depositing. The best Apple Pay casino Australia 2026 instant deposit options usually have a $5 minimum.

Can I withdraw winnings using Apple Pay?

No, Apple Pay is a deposit-only method. Withdrawals go back to your linked bank account or card. This is standard for all casinos. Withdrawal times vary from 1-5 business days.

Are there any fees for using Apple Pay at casinos?

Apple Pay itself charges no fees. But some casinos might treat it as a credit card transaction and charge a small fee (1-3%). I’ve only seen this at a few sites. Most don’t charge anything.
